Mahjong: The Wall of Memory Mahjong: The Wall of Memory is a clear, practical, and accessible guide designed to teach you how to play Mahjong step by step even if you have never touched a tile before. This book leads the reader from the basic concepts to a true understanding of the game, the same way it is learned around a real table: by observing, asking questions, and practicing. Throughout its pages, the rules, combinations, tile values, scoring system, and the most common situations that arise during a game are explained in a simple and easy-to-follow way. The guide is based on the American Mahjong variant as it has traditionally been played in Caracas, Venezuela , with helpful instructional adaptations that make learning easier and allow readers to play with confidence, teach others, and fully enjoy the game. In this book, you will learn: How to set up the table, build the wall, and deal the tiles. - The meaning of suits, honors, flowers, and jokers. - How to form sets, runs, kong-like combinations, and winning hands. - When and how to correctly declare Mahjong. - How to calculate points, doubles, limits, and payments. - Special rules, penalties, and real-life gameplay situations.
